Dive into the vibrant world of Marathi pop with Anand Shinde's "Kombda Shirlya (D.J. Mix)," a lively and energetic album that brings a fresh twist to traditional sounds. Released on January 6, 2009, under the esteemed T-Series label, this album is a testament to Anand Shinde's musical prowess and his ability to blend contemporary beats with classic Marathi melodies. Collaborating with Milind Shinde, the duo delivers a dynamic collection of tracks that are sure to get you moving.
The album features ten remixed tracks, each expertly crafted by Rajeev Bhatt, known for his innovative approach to music production. From the playful "Gubu Gubu Vaajtai" to the rhythmic "Opening Jhalaya Doodh Kendracha," every song is a celebration of Marathi culture and modern music. Standout tracks like "Uthlyavar Ekda" and "Baburao Taait Kela" showcase the album's infectious energy and catchy tunes, while "Jabu Daya Leland" and "Taratara Faattay" add a touch of whimsy and charm.
With a total runtime of 54 minutes, "Kombda Shirlya (D.J. Mix)" is a perfect blend of tradition and innovation, making it an essential addition to any music lover's collection. Anand Shinde is a celebrated Marathi playback singer, known for his captivating voice and enchanting melodies. Hailing from a family of singers, Anand carries forward a rich legacy of music, with his father and grandfather also being renowned singers. His songs, such as "Dp Chi Gheu Ka Pappi" and "Baai Kamala Ye," are beloved by fans, showcasing his versatility and ability to infuse energy and flavor into his music.
